## Rationale
What more can be said about [fzf](https://github.com/junegunn/fzf)? It is the
single most impactful tool for my command line workflow, once I started using
fzf I couldnt see myself living without it.
> **To understand fzf properly I highly recommended [fzf
> screencast](https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=qgG5Jhi_Els) by
> [@samoshkin](https://github.com/samoshkin)**
This is my take on the original
[fzf.vim](https://github.com/junegunn/fzf.vim), written in lua for neovim 0.5,
it builds on the elegant
[nvim-fzf](https://github.com/vijaymarupudi/nvim-fzf) as an async interface to
create a performant and lightweight fzf client for neovim that rivals any of
the new shiny fuzzy finders for neovim.

## Dependencies
- `Linux` or `MacOS`
- [`neovim`](https://github.com/neovim/neovim/releases) version > 0.5.0
- [`fzf`](https://github.com/junegunn/fzf) version > 0.24.0 **or**
[`skim`](https://github.com/lotabout/skim) binary installed
- [nvim-web-devicons](https://github.com/kyazdani42/nvim-web-devicons)
(optional)
### Optional dependencies
- [fd](https://github.com/sharkdp/fd) - better `find` utility
- [rg](https://github.com/BurntSushi/ripgrep) - better `grep` utility
- [bat](https://github.com/sharkdp/bat) - syntax highlighted previews when
using fzf's native previewer
- [delta](https://github.com/dandavison/delta) - syntax highlighted git pager
for git status previews
- [viu](https://github.com/atanunq/viu) - terminal image previews (needs to be
configured via `previewer.builtin.extensions`)
- [ueberzug](https://github.com/seebye/ueberzug) - X11 image previews (needs to
be configured via `previewer.builtin.extensions`)
- [nvim-dap](https://github.com/mfussenegger/nvim-dap) - for Debug Adapter
Protocol (DAP) support

## Usage
Fzf-lua aims to be as plug and play as possible with sane defaults, you can
run any fzf-lua command like this:
```lua
:lua require('fzf-lua').files()
-- or using the `FzfLua` vim command:
:FzfLua files
```
or with arguments:
```lua
:lua require('fzf-lua').files({ cwd = '~/.config' })
-- or using the `FzfLua` vim command:
:FzfLua files cwd=~/.config
```
which can be easily mapped to:
```vim
nnoremap <c-P> <cmd>lua require('fzf-lua').files()<CR>
```
or if using `init.lua`:
```lua
vim.api.nvim_set_keymap('n', '<c-P>',
"<cmd>lua require('fzf-lua').files()<CR>",
{ noremap = true, silent = true })
```
## Commands
### Buffers and Files
| Command | List |
| ---------------- | ------------------------------------------ |
| `buffers` | open buffers |
| `files` | `find` or `fd` on a path |
| `oldfiles` | opened files history |
| `quickfix` | quickfix list |
| `loclist` | location list |
| `lines` | open buffers lines |
| `blines` | current buffer lines |
| `tabs` | open tabs |
| `args` | argument list |
### Search
| Command | List |
| ---------------- | ------------------------------------------ |
| `grep` | search for a pattern with `grep` or `rg` |
| `grep_last` | run search again with the last pattern |
| `grep_cword` | search word under cursor |
| `grep_cWORD` | search WORD under cursor |
| `grep_visual` | search visual selection |
| `grep_project` | search all project lines (fzf.vim's `:Rg`) |
| `grep_curbuf` | search current buffer lines |
| `lgrep_curbuf` | live grep current buffer |
| `live_grep` | live grep current project |
| `live_grep_resume` | live grep continue last search |

| `live_grep_glob` | live_grep with `rg --glob` support |
| `live_grep_native` | performant version of `live_grep` |
### Tags
| Command | List |
| ---------------- | ------------------------------------------ |
| `tags` | search project tags |
| `btags` | search buffer tags |
| `tags_grep` | grep project tags |
| `tags_grep_cword` | `tags_grep` word under cursor |
| `tags_grep_cWORD` | `tags_grep` WORD under cursor |
| `tags_grep_visual` | `tags_grep` visual selection |
| `tags_live_grep` | live grep project tags |
### Git
| Command | List |
| ---------------- | ------------------------------------------ |
| `git_files` | `git ls-files` |
| `git_status` | `git status` |
| `git_commits` | git commit log (project) |
| `git_bcommits` | git commit log (buffer) |
| `git_branches` | git branches |
### LSP
| Command | List |
| ---------------- | ------------------------------------------ |
| `lsp_references` | References |
| `lsp_definitions` | Definitions |
| `lsp_declarations` | Declarations |
| `lsp_typedefs` | Type Definitions |
| `lsp_implementations` | Implementations |
| `lsp_document_symbols` | Document Symbols |
| `lsp_workspace_symbols` | Workspace Symbols |
| `lsp_live_workspace_symbols` | Workspace Symbols (live query) |
| `lsp_code_actions` | Code Actions |
| `lsp_document_diagnostics` | Document Diagnostics |
| `lsp_workspace_diagnostics` | Workspace Diagnostics |
| `lsp_incoming_calls` | Incoming Calls |
| `lsp_outgoing_calls` | Outgoing Calls |
### Misc
| Command | List |
| ---------------- | ------------------------------------------ |
| `resume` | resume last command/query |
| `builtin` | fzf-lua builtin commands |
| `help_tags` | help tags |
| `man_pages` | man pages |
| `colorschemes` | color schemes |
| `highlights` | highlight groups |
| `commands` | neovim commands |
| `command_history` | command history |
| `search_history` | search history |
| `marks` | :marks |
| `jumps` | :jumps |
| `changes` | :changes |
| `registers` | :registers |
| `tagstack` | :tags |
| `keymaps` | key mappings |
| `spell_suggest` | spelling suggestions |
| `filetypes` | neovim filetypes |
| `packadd` | :packadd <package> |
### Neovim API
> `:help vim.ui.select` for more info
| Command | List |
| -------------------- | -------------------------------------- |
| `register_ui_select` | register fzf-lua as the UI interface for `vim.ui.select`|
| `deregister_ui_select` | de-register fzf-lua with `vim.ui.select` |
### nvim-dap
> Requires [`nvim-dap`](https://github.com/mfussenegger/nvim-dap)
| Command | List |
| -------------------- | ------------------------------------------ |
| `dap_commands` | list,run `nvim-dap` builtin commands |
| `dap_configurations` | list,run debug configurations |
| `dap_breakpoints` | list,delete breakpoints |
| `dap_variables` | active session variables |
| `dap_frames` | active session jump to frame |
